How We Work
1
Immediate Contact
Your call connects you directly with a certified technician. We gather initial details about the water damage and dispatch a rapid response team to your Asheville property. Quick action prevents further damage.
2
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our team uses specialized mo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ately assess the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our custom drying plan and identifies all affected areas.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ial-grade extractors remove standing water quickly. We then strategically place high-volume air movers and dehumidifiers to begin the thorough drying process, preventing mold growth.
4
Drying & Monitoring
We continuously monitor temperature, humidity, and moisture levels. Our team makes necessary adjustments to equipment, ensuring optimal drying conditions until structural materials are completely dry and safe.
5
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, we proceed with any necessary repairs or reconstruction. Our goal is to return your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the restoration with a final quality check.

High-Velocity Air Mover Drying v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, contained water damage in a bathroom or kitchen Yes No DIY methods can handle small, contained water damage.
Large-scale water damage covering multiple rooms No Yes Professional help is needed for complex water damage situations.
Water damage caused by a burst pipe in a hard-to-reach area No Yes DIY methods can't handle complex or hard-to-reach water damage situations.
A musty smell that won't go away, possibly due to mold growth No Yes Professional help is needed to identify and remove mold growth.
Water damage caused by a natural disaster, such as a flood No Yes Professional help is essential for large-scale water damage situations.
A small leak in a roof or wall that's not causing significant damage Yes No DIY methods can handle small, contained leaks.

High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Cost In Parker, SC

The cost of High-Velocity Air Mover Drying in Parker, SC will depend on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. You can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 or more, dep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Service $500 - $2,500 Severity of water dam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Equipment Rental Fee $100 - $500 Type of equipment needed, rental duration
Water Removal Service $200 - $1,000 Amount of water to be removed, equipment needed
Dehumidification Service $100 - $500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Odor Removal Service $50 - $200 Severity of odor, type of equipment needed
